Having fallen in love with the moorland, Sue and Steve Osmond built a cabin, so friends can share their corner of Cornwall

- ANNABELLE GRUNDY

MAGIC OF THE MOOR

AT HOME WITH

Owners Sue Osmond, regional manager of a rural membership organisation (cla.org.uk), and her husband Steve, a retired Royal Navy engineer. The couple bought the property in 2011.

House One-bedroom timberclad cabin with a slate roof.

After many years of holidaying in North Cornwall, Sue and Steve Osmond felt the time was right to make a permanent move to the area. The couple sold their Dorset home and took a holiday cottage near Bodmin Moor, while they searched for a place to put down roots.

‘We wanted a rural spot, with a bit of space, and within striking distance of Polzeath Beach, which is one of our favourites,’ says Sue. ‘While we were out on the moor one day, we noticed this remote farmhouse up a track, and incredibly, it was for sale. The views were just spectacular, and we simply fell in love with it.’

The two-bedroom, 200-year-old property sat on a plot with a large barn and a dilapidated summer house. Sue and Steve spent their first few years renovating the farmhouse, and settling into life on the moor.
